Folks, since I had the FIRST nitrous powered Marauder (on and running at Marauderville I, Sept 2003), and I used the very same kit(klmore got it from someone else that bought it from me, but was threatened with divorce if he didn't get rid of it). I can, in good faith, tell you that, if properly installed (which is quite simple, and takes only a couple hours), a shot up to 125 hp will not require modification of the tune, since the EEC V adapts all timing retards automatically, and the nitrous application will not hurt your hypereutectic pistons or stock rods. ANYTHING above that requires a professional tune from Superchips or Diablo (I recommend Superchips). You can make up to 425 hp safely with the ZEX. It's more than most people really want in a street machine. I opted to upgrade to an NOS NOSZle system, which is direct through the injector ports.
